The Martech Leadership Retreat is a three-day, invite-only experience designed for marketing technology executives and innovators shaping the future of marketing.
Through a mix of strategic sessions, case studies, solo success stories, and peer-led conversations, this retreat offers space to explore what’s next in Martech from adoption and orchestration to measurement and predictive engagement.
Set in a relaxed environment with curated networking experiences, including a riverboat dinner and outdoor connection time, attendees will gain not just insight, but also relationships that fuel real transformation.
Whether you're leading digital change within a large enterprise or building something powerful on your own, this retreat is your chance to step back, get inspired, and return with sharper tools and fresh clarity.
